“Apollon Hotel KosTown Kos Greece”
2 of 5 stars Reviewed 9 October 2011
8
people found this review helpful

Apollon's like a good 3 stars hotel, not 4. Sometime you wait to sit down during breakfast or dinner time and often you have only pork or only fish dishes and there's always the same plumcake! Every morning there's a competition to reserve a sunbed with your towel – 180 rooms and about 50 sunbeds, more or less. Every room have air-conditioning but some night there has been a power-cut and so … !!! In my room there was a wall cupboard … two pieces of wood ( room num. 431). The swimming pool is beatuful but dirty and every morning a man, avoiding someone's eyes, spout something – I don't know what.

“Looking to chill out by the pool?This is the place.”
5 of 5 stars Reviewed 29 September 2011 via mobile
3
people found this review helpful

Stayed at the Apollon last week it was brilliant! Great value all inclusive holiday. The food was really good, being a veggie sometimes a problem but there was a huge choice of salads and veg.
The pool & gardens are beautiful as is the Hotel main areas (free wi fi) the rooms are clean and comfortable, quite basic but I wasn't moving in :) Never went to the beach so can't comment. Kos town is 10 minutes away by bus from outside the hotel (€1.20) Would go again next year.

“Nice gardens, good food”
4 of 5 stars Reviewed 12 August 2011
4
people found this review helpful

We stayed at the Apollon for one week in August 2011. The hotel is really nice, although it is a bit far from the city centre. The wind on the beach nearby is not so strong as on the Southern beaches, so swimming is quite pleasant. The rooms and the food at the hotel are good. Everybody tried to be very nice and helpful. The pool is clean, but you need to "reserve" the place in the morning. The only annoying thing is that there is no wireless at the hotel (which is really strange and dissappointing, since most of the cafes in town have free wi-fi). Nice stay, but I would not be back as I think wireless is not a luxury, but a need today.

“Great Place Great people”
4 of 5 stars Reviewed 21 July 2011
7
people found this review helpful

Just back from a weeks All Inclusive, had a great stay at the Apollon, room was spotless and cleaned every day. Also supplied with clean towels every day. On arrival at 11.30pm the receptionist checked us in within minutes and then got us a chicken salad to eat from the restaurant. In general all the staff were superb, Sylvia on the bar during the day seemed grumpy but was the total opposite, but sometimes cleaning the bar came before serving the people! Food wasn't the best I must say, was very repetetive, but to be fair there was always plenty to eat and was topped up regularly. Would recommend a visit to Tigaki beach which was only approx 8km away. Hired a scooter from the place next door to the hotel for the day which cost only 13 euros. Would recommend to anyone for a holiday. 2 mins walk towards town there's a great bar called Flinstones, great value for money there, 2 euros for large beer and 3 for cocktails, then a little further down on opposte side of Flintstones you'll find a fantastic English Bar called Delons its a must, very quiet but great hosts, Fantastic English breakfast and has all the football on (if wanted) best bar we found in the week and there's plenty of them, All in All its a great place to be,
